ProfileWalter Schleimer is a partner in the Finance and Real Estate Practice Groups in Haynes and Boone's New York office. He practices commercial real estate law, with a primary focus on finance transactions. Walter regularly represents investment banks, commercial banks, debt funds and foreign lending institutions in their mortgage loan, mezzanine loan, preferred equity and other complex real estate transactions. He also represents investment funds and REITs in their financing transactions, including structured loans, syndicated loans, subscription lines and other credit facilities. Walter represents institutional lenders and borrowers in their loan work-outs and restructurings, including complex CMBS restructures, as well as matters that result in mortgage foreclosure, UUC sale or other enforcement proceedings or bankruptcy resolution. Walter represents institutional owners and developers in acquisition, joint venture, redevelopment, sales, and other traditional real estate transactions. He has also been selected for inclusion in Super Lawyers for Real Estate Law (2006-2010).
